Yoga for Beginners A Step-by-Step Guide to Getting Started

Yoga is a wonderful practice that offers numerous physical and mental benefits. Whether you’re looking to improve flexibility, build strength, reduce stress, or enhance overall well-being, yoga can be a great addition to your routine. If you’re a beginner, here’s a step-by-step guide to help you get started:

Set Your Intention: Begin by clarifying your intention for practicing yoga. Reflect on what you hope to gain from the practice, whether it’s increased flexibility, stress relief, or mindfulness. This will help you stay focused and motivated throughout your yoga journey.

Choose a Suitable Style: There are various styles of yoga, each with its own focus and intensity. For beginners, it’s generally recommended to start with a gentle or beginner-friendly style, such as Hatha or Vinyasa flow. These styles offer a balanced combination of poses (asanas), breathwork (pranayama), and relaxation.

Find a Qualified Teacher: It’s important to learn yoga from a qualified teacher who can guide you through proper alignment and technique. Look for local yoga studios or online platforms that offer beginner classes or specific programs for beginners. A knowledgeable teacher can provide instructions, modifications, and support as you begin your yoga practice.

Get the Right Equipment: To start practicing yoga, you’ll need a few basic items. A yoga mat provides grip and cushioning, making your practice more comfortable. Wear comfortable, stretchy clothing that allows for ease of movement. Props such as blocks, straps, and bolsters can also be helpful for modifications and support.

Start with Basic Poses: Begin your practice with foundational yoga poses that focus on alignment, balance, and breath awareness. Some common beginner poses include Mountain Pose (Tadasana), Downward-Facing Dog (Adho Mukha Svanasana), Warrior I (Virabhadrasana I), and Child’s Pose (Balasana). Take your time to explore each pose, paying attention to proper alignment and breathing.

Practice Mindful Breathing: Breathing is an integral part of yoga. Throughout your practice, pay attention to your breath, aiming for slow, deep, and controlled inhalations and exhalations. This helps calm the mind, deepen the practice, and cultivate a sense of mindfulness.

Gradually Increase Duration and Intensity: Start with shorter practice sessions, such as 15-20 minutes, and gradually increase the duration as you build strength and stamina. Be kind to yourself and pay attention to your body. Avoid pushing yourself too hard or forcing yourself into difficult stances. Proceed at a comfortable and sustainable pace for you.

Embrace Consistency: Consistency is key in establishing a yoga practice. Aim for regular sessions, even if they’re shorter in duration. Consistency helps you build strength, improve flexibility, and experience the cumulative benefits of yoga over time.

Practice Mindfulness and Self-Care: Yoga is not just about physical practice; it also encourages mindfulness and self-care. Take time to reflect, connect with your breath, and be present at the moment during your practice. Additionally, prioritize self-care practices such as rest, hydration, and nourishing yourself with a balanced diet.

Stay Open and Enjoy the Journey: Approach your yoga practice with an open mind and a sense of curiosity. Every day on the mat is different, and your practice will evolve over time. Be kind to yourself, celebrate small victories, and enjoy the journey of self-discovery and growth that yoga offers.

Remember, yoga is a personal practice, and it’s about honoring your body and its limitations. Be patient, stay consistent, and embrace the process. With time, you’ll experience the physical, mental, and spiritual benefits of yoga as it becomes an integral part of your lifestyle.
